Wile E. Coyote's ACME Flyer, as depicted in various "Looney Tunes" cartoons, typically humorously illustrates the theme of converting stored potential energy, such as chemical energy from fuel or mechanical energy from compressed springs, into kinetic energy as it takes flight. The contraptions often showcase Wile E.'s outlandish inventions powered by ACME products, leading to a variety of zany outcomes, rather than a strict adherence to realistic physics or engineering principles. In a nutshell, the Flyer symbolizes the transformation of potential energy into kinetic energy, albeit in a comedic and exaggerated manner.
